RECOMMENDED ACTION
Adopt a resolution that amends the City's Basic Management Classification
and Compensation Plan (Resolution No. 91-066) and amends the Fiscal Year
2006-07 Annual Budget to reallocate one position.
DISCUSSION
The Clerk of the Council Office has conducted an analysis of the duties
and responsibilities of their Senior Management Analyst position
following the departure of the incumbent. This position's main
responsibilities have been developing the Office's budget, supervising
staff, and completing special proj ects and assignments as appropriate.
However, the organizational review has concluded that these duties would
be performed more efficiently and effectively by a middle management
classification performing professional and technical duties specific to a
Clerk's Office. Such a classification would also serve as a bridge class
to the Clerk of the Council position when the need to search for a
successor arises.
Therefore, the Clerk of the Council is proposing the creation of a
classification titled Chief Assistant Clerk of the Council (MM) and the
reallocation of the Senior Management Analyst position to this new
classification. The Chief Assistant Clerk of the Council will perform
highly responsible administrative and managerial work in directing and
coordinating the activities of the Clerk of the Council Office and will
act as the Clerk of the Council in the incumbent's absence.

FISCAL IMPACT
Assuming an effective date of May 1, 2007, the cost of the reallocation
is $1,622 for the remainder of the fiscal year. Funds are available in
the Clerk of the Council's salary account.

RESOLUTION NO. 2007-
A RESOLUTION OF TH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F
SANTA ANA TO AMEND RESOLUTION NO. 91-066 TO
AMEND THE CITY'S BASIC CLASSIFICATION AND
COMPENSATION PLAN TO ADD ONE NEW FULL TIME
CLASSIFICATION TITLE IN THE OFFICE OF THE CLERK OF
THE COUNCIL, AND TO AMEND THE ANNUAL BUDGET TO
REALLOCATE ONE POSITION.
BE IT RESOLVED BY TH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F SANTA ANA AS
FOLLOWS:
Section 1: The City Council hereby finds, determines and declares as follows:
A. Section 1004, Article X of the City Charter of the City of Santa Ana
requires the City Manager to prepare, install and maintain a position
classification and pay plan subject to civil service rules and regulations
and the approval of the City Council.
B. On July 1, 1991, the City Council passed and adopted Resolution
No. 91-066, re-establishing the Basic Classification and Compensation
Plan for classes of employment designated as Executive Management
(EM) and Middle Management (MM).
C. On June 19, 2006, the City Council passed and adopted Ordinance No.
NS-2713, establishing the City's Annual Budget and authorizing position
allocations for Fiscal Year 2006-2007. The Ordinance also sets forth the
requirement that alterations in the allocation of authorized positions be
reviewed and approved by the City Council.
D. The City of Santa Ana and the Santa Ana Management Association
(SAMA) representing employees in classifications designated as
represented Middle Management and Administrative Management, have
negotiated a Memorandum of Understanding (MOU) to provide certain
adjustments in salaries, benefits and other terms and conditions of
employment for SAMA represented employees during Fiscal Years
2004 - 2010.
E. It is the City's practice to assign job titles that accurately reflect the duties
and responsibilities of the classification and are consistent with other
classifications within the City's organizational structure.
F. The Clerk of the Council proposes to create one full time classification
title, and to reallocate one position in the current Annual Budget.
55A-3
G. It is now desired to amend Council Resolution No. 91-066, as amended,
and the Annual Budget for Fiscal Year 2006-2007, as amended, in order
to effect these changes.
Section 2: That Section 3B of Resolution No. 91-066, as amended, is hereby
further amended by:
A. Adding, in alphabetical sequence, the following classification title at the
monthly fifteen-step salary rate range and effective date indicated:
Classification Title
15-Step Salary Rate Ranae (SRR) Effective 5/01/07'
SRR Monthlv Salary (Min-Max)
Chief Assistant Clerk of
the Council (MM)
MM-12
(monthly min $5341- max $7546)
B. Designating the newly created classification title of Chief Assistant Clerk of
the Council as Middle Management by assigning the parenthetical identifier "(MM)" after
this classification title.
,
Future salary levels shall be determined per Article V, Subsections 5.3 (0 through
H) of the SAMA MOU for Fiscal Years 2004-2010.
Section 3: That Ordinance No. NS-2713, the Annual Budget for Fiscal Year
2006-2007, as amended, is hereby further amended by reallocating one full time
position from the classification title of Senior Management Analyst (UC), SRR 662
(monthly min $5278 - max $6735), to the classification title of Chief Assistant Clerk of
the Council (MM), SRR MM-12 (monthly min $5341 - max $7546).
Section 4: That Resolution 2006-074 amending the Conflict of Interest Codes
of certain City Agencies, is hereby further amended to delete the position of Senior
Management Analyst, Disclosure Category 4, from the Clerk of the Council schedule
listed in Exhibit A, and to add the position of Chief Assistant Clerk of the Council (MM),
Disclosure Category 4, to the Clerk of the Council schedule listed in Exhibit A.
Section 5: That except as amended by this Resolution, all other provisions of
Resolution No. 91-066, as amended, Resolution 2006-074, as amended, and the
Annual Budget for Fiscal Year 2006-2007, as amended, shall remain in full force and
effect.
